https://bugs.koha-community.org/bugzilla3/show_bug.cgi?id=43516 --- Comment #1 from Martin Renvoize (ashimema) <martin.renvoize@openfifth.co.uk> --- Created attachment 205526 --> https://bugs.koha-community.org/bugzilla3/attachment.cgi?id=205526&action=edit Bug 43516: Harden HttpClient against malformed and unreachable API responses Guard against malformed JSON in http-client responses (a truncated body, a proxy error page, a session-expired redirect) instead of letting the parse error surface as the failure. Preserve the HTTP status and Koha error_code on thrown errors so callers can branch on them. Add a per-request config object to both the plain fetch/http-client.js and the Vue-composable vue/fetch/http-client.js: - config.signal cancels the underlying fetch via AbortController. - config.suppressDefaultErrorDialog lets callers that present their own error UI skip the page-level error dialog; the error is still thrown with status/code attached.
